Our Correspondent
KANGRA, SEPTEMBER 1
Bikram Thakur, BJP MLA, Jaswan–Pragpur constituency, today criticised the Central team for inspecting the site proposed for Central University at Jadrangal when the site at Dehra has already been selected.
He said the Congress government was in power for the last four years, but it had failed to provide suitable land for construction of the central university.
Thakur said the state government had offered about 7,000 kanals of land at Dehra and transferred it in the name of Central University through a Cabinet decision.
Based on the report submitted on April 23, 2010 by the site selection committee appointed by the Central Government, it was decided that there will be two campuses of this university. One will be at Dehra ‘Beas campus’ accommodating 70 per cent of the infrastructure as the main campus and the second will be ‘Dhauldhar campus’ at Dharamsala which will have 30 per cent of the academic activities. The state government processed the case for transfer of land and the NDA Government at the Centre accorded forest clearance too.
He asked when the site was selected and approved by the site selection committee then why a fresh committee arrived today in the district. It said it was an attempt to deprive Kangra of the the Central university.
